Sevastopol Pre-School is a State/Public serving prekindergarten age pupils, located in Sturgeon Bay, Door County. The school has 24 pupils enrolled. It is part of the Sevastopol School District school district. It serves grades Pre-K in a rural setting. The school employs 3.2 full-time-equivalent teachers, a student-teacher ratio of 7.5:1. Sevastopol Pre-School enrolls 24 students across grades Pre-K. The student body is 50% male and 50% female. A teaching staff of 3.2 full-time-equivalent teachers supports the school, giving a student-teacher ratio of 7.5:1.
By race and ethnicity, the student body is 75% White and 25% Hispanic or Latino.
| Race / ethnicity | Students | Share |
|---|---|---|
| White | 18 | 75% |
| Hispanic or Latino | 6 | 25% |
Source: NCES Common Core of Data.
7 of the school's 24 students (29%) qualify for free or reduced-price lunch. Of these, 7 qualify for free lunch and 0 for a reduced price. The school participates in the National School Lunch Program. Free and reduced-price lunch eligibility is a widely used indicator of the share of students from lower-income households.
Sevastopol Pre-School is located in a rural setting (NCES locale: Rural, Distant). Virtual instruction: Supplemental Virtual. For civic and policy purposes, the school sits in congressional district WI-80, state senate district 1, state house district 1.
Sevastopol Pre-School is one of 4 schools in Sevastopol School District, based in Sturgeon Bay, Wisconsin. The district serves 606 students district-wide and employs 52 full-time-equivalent teachers. With 24 students, Sevastopol Pre-School is smaller than the district average of about 152 students per school.
